Data Speaks: Europe's Renewable Energy Tipping Point
Consider these critical metrics:
- Solar generation in the EU grew by 24% YoY in 2023 (SolarPower Europe)
- Energy storage deployments are projected to hit 44 GW by 2030 across Europe
- 70% of solar developers now cite storage integration as their top technical challenge
These aren't abstract numbers - they reflect the daily reality for grid operators in Spain facing 5-hour solar peaks, or UK communities where winter demand spikes strain aging infrastructure. The old model of standalone solar farms? It's becoming economically unviable without intelligent storage solutions.

Insights: The 3 Pillars of Future-Ready Energy Storage
Our analysis of 42 European solar+storage projects reveals critical patterns:
- Adaptability Beats Capacity: Systems with smart charge algorithms outperformed larger batteries by 23% in ROI
- Grid Symbiosis Matters: Projects co-designed with TSOs reduced interconnection delays by 11 months on average
- Revenue Resilience: Multi-stream monetization cut payback periods below 7 years despite regulatory shifts
What does this mean practically? Consider Portugal's recent solar auctions where winning bids all featured storage flexibility. Or Denmark's new grid codes requiring synthetic inertia from solar plants. Your supplier's technical foresight now directly impacts project viability.
